Decoding Meghan Markle's Birth Certificate
The birth certificate of Meghan Markle is more than just a document; it's a snapshot of a moment in time, chronicling the beginning of a life that would eventually capture the world's attention. For those of you curious about what exactly a birth certificate contains, it typically includes full name at birth, date and time of birth, place of birth (hospital or other location), parent's names, parent's ages, parent's places of birth, and the attending physician's name. This information is crucial for establishing legal identity and is used for various administrative purposes throughout a person's life.
Meghan Markle's birth certificate, like any other, would have contained these standard pieces of information. The focus often lies on verifying the accuracy of these details, especially concerning her parents, Doria Ragland and Thomas Markle, and the location of her birth, which was in Los Angeles, California. Common Misconceptions
Let's clear up some common misconceptions about Meghan Markle's birth certificate. One prevalent myth is that the birth certificate contains hidden secrets or scandalous information. In reality, birth certificates are fairly straightforward documents that primarily serve to establish identity and record basic facts about a person's birth. While they are important legal documents, they typically do not contain sensational or controversial details.
Another misconception is that discrepancies or errors on a birth certificate automatically invalidate a person's identity or legal status. While accuracy is certainly important, minor errors are not uncommon and can usually be corrected through a simple amendment process. Significant discrepancies might raise questions, but they do not automatically nullify the document's validity. It's essential to approach such issues with a balanced perspective and avoid jumping to conclusions based on incomplete information.
Additionally, some people believe that obtaining a copy of a celebrity's birth certificate is easily done. In reality, birth certificates are considered private documents and are typically only accessible to the individual named on the certificate, their immediate family members, or authorized legal representatives. Unauthorized access to or distribution of such documents can have legal consequences.
